Don Oscar Tiburcio Ramon, a beacon of resilience and generosity, was a man whose life story is a testament to the power of perseverance and the human spirit. Born and raised in the vibrant city of Veracruz, Mexico, Don Oscar's life took a dramatic turn when the Carlos Salina de Gortari administration decided to take over the port of Veracruz in 1991. Undeterred by the challenges that lay ahead, Don Oscar made the bold decision to migrate to the United States, seeking a better future for himself and his family. His journey led him to the scenic Pacific Northwest, where he started a new life, a testament to his courage and determination. Don Oscar was not just a man of action, but also a man of immense kindness and generosity. Always ready to lend a helping hand, he was a pillar of support for those around him. His wisdom was a guiding light for those seeking advice or wanting to learn about life. His legacy of kindness and wisdom continues to live on in the hearts of those who knew him. Survived by his four children, three boys and one girl, and his devoted wife, Don Oscar's memory is cherished every day. His life was a testament to his commitment to his family, standing by them through the good, the bad, and the ugly. He was instrumental in helping them start a new life, a feat that speaks volumes about his character. Don Oscar Tiburcio Ramon was more than just a man; he was a symbol of resilience, a source of wisdom, and a beacon of generosity. His life and achievements continue to inspire, reminding us of the power of perseverance, the importance of kindness, and the value of family. His story is a shining example of how one man's determination can create a lasting legacy. Don Oscar, you are greatly missed, but your spirit lives on.
